How much do remote work from home hospitality j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 25,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ote work from home hospitality in the United States is $18.19,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.18 and $19.23 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is remote work from home hospitality?

Remote work from home hospitality refers to jobs within the hospitality industry—such as reservations, guest services, event planning, and customer support—that can be performed from a remote location, typically one's home. These roles leverage technology to interact with guests, coordinate bookings, handle inquiries, and provide service virtually rather than in person at hotels or travel companies. This setup allows employees to enjoy the flexibility of working from home while still delivering high-quality hospitality experiences to clients and guests.

What are some common challenges faced when working remotely in hospitality, and how can they be managed?

One common challenge in remote hospitality roles is maintaining effective communication with both guests and team members, since interactions are virtual rather than face-to-face. To manage this, it’s important to use reliable communication tools and establish clear protocols for responding to inquiries and collaborating with colleagues. Additionally, remote workers must be proactive in staying updated on property policies and guest needs, as well as adept at troubleshooting technology issues. Building strong digital rapport and practicing empathetic customer service can help ensure guest satisfaction, even from a distance.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in a remote work from home hospitality position, and why are they important?

To thrive in a remote work-from-home hospitality role, you need excellent customer service skills, attention to detail, and relevant experience or training in hospitality operations. Familiarity with property management systems (PMS), online reservation platforms, and communication tools like email and chat software is typically required. Strong interpersonal skills, self-motivation, and the ability to solve problems independently help individuals stand out in this position. These competencies are essential for delivering seamless guest experiences and maintaining high service standards without in-person supervision.
